Just to hammer another nail in the coffin of this bootlegging issue, I saw an amusing sight yesterday. There is a massive series of Pink Floyd bootleg trance remixes available. Somebody (allegedly Alex Patterson, though my guess is that it was one of those KLF goons) remixes each album, and released it separately. The one's I've seen were the Dark Side of the Moon, Wish you were Here, Division Bell and Animals "limited edition" trance remixes. This, OBVIOUSLY, isn't legal.
